I have indeed enjoyed the Conti TerrainContact ATs in mixed driving; mostly paved around town and long road trips but also some fun offroad outings that involved gravel/loose surface, water crossings, mud, mild snow, and beach driving. They aren't the most aggressive *looking* tire but they definitely have more presence than a straight street tire. For my needs they've been just about perfect. I wish the lug profile was a little more pronounced around the shoulder purely for looks, to be honest. But it's a cool tire. If I change them out once the tread is beat, I'd only move to something else because I like variety. I could also easily put another set of these on and be very happy.

I must say that my initial enthusiasm has not dropped off. I think I've got somewhere north of 40K miles on these and they're still going strong. You may have read the post where I cut a sidewall while offroading in the woods, but I can't blame that on the tire. It was a fluke where a sharp rock was protruding from a muddy bank that caught me just right.

I got mine on a decent deal from DiscountTires and I recall paying just under $200 a corner delivered. Not bargain basement but not outlandish as decent tires go.
